If you think NVIDIA's margins are obscene, you haven't seen anything yet, quite literally. After all, Precigenitics, a biotech company that focuses on live-cell drug discovery, has just inked a $2.3 million deal at a potential margin of over 95 percent! You can fabricate microfluidic environment chips for around $30 to over $500, but Precigenetics has just sold 11 of these chips at $200,000 each For the benefit of those who might not be aware, instead of analyzing traditional, static cellular snapshots, or destroying cells during testing, Precigenetics uses a photonic-AI platform - called Cell Cinema - to continuously image […]
